Car Key Battery Replacement

If your car key fob isn't working, you may have dead or low batteries. It is easy to replace a key fob battery in your car at home.

First, check what type of battery your device requires. Most are 3 Volt or CR2025 batteries that can be found in electronics stores and hardware retailers.

Modern cars come with key fobs that come with a separate battery. The most common car key battery replacement is a CR2032 battery, which is cheap and easy to find at stores like Batteries Plus.

To change the battery in your key fob, you'll need to open it up. Most key fobs feature an elongated clamshell design. It has two halves that snap together. It is usually possible to open the key fob by using a butter knife or fingernail. However, some are tighter and will require a screwdriver to pull apart.

After the two halves are separated the circuit board as well as the battery can be viewed. Be careful not to lose any screws or wires in this process. It's also a good idea to take a photo or note down the location of the old battery placed on the key fob so that you can place the new one in the same orientation.

After removing the old battery, you can insert a new one in the same position. Be sure to check that the new battery has both sides. Once the battery is installed, you can place the circuit board on top of it and snap back the two halves together.

First, you'll need to locate the battery that was used. The best way to do this is by finding an image of some kind printed on the top or back of the battery itself and it should be clear enough to be read with a magnifying lens. You can also refer to the owner's manual for your vehicle, or ask someone in the service department of your dealership to identify the type you need.

It's time to replace your old battery when you've found it! Gently pry the fob apart at the seam using a flat screwdriver, or a coin. Be careful not to scratch the plastic casing or any electronic components within. Once you've opened the fob, be sure to remove the battery you have used, taking note of which side is positive and which is negative to make sure you insert the new battery in the same way.

Insert a fresh new battery, and snap the two halves of the fob back together. Be sure to test the key fob before you leave to ensure the replacement battery is working properly. If everything is working properly you are now able to go out on the road!

The car key fob is a great tool for ensuring your vehicle's security. They allow you to lock and unlock the doors with the press of an arrow, as well as unlocking your trunk and tailgate. They are powered by batteries, and it's crucial to replace them on a regular basis so they can continue working exactly as they were intended to. It's good to know that changing the battery on your car key fob isn't that difficult and you can do it yourself using only a few steps.

First, you'll need to open the key fob. This process varies by manufacturer, but you'll typically need to use either a flat screwdriver, or a sturdy fingernail to pry the fob apart at the joint. You should be careful to not damage any internal components when you open your key fob.

Remove the battery that was in it after you've opened the fob. It should easily pop out thanks to an internal spring If not you can try using more than one location around the fob and apply gentle pressure. Then, you can insert the new battery into the compartment and make sure it is in the correct direction.

The battery used in the car key fob is a common button cell that you can find them at a wide range of general stores as well as home improvement stores and auto accessory shops. Alternatively, you can also purchase them on the internet through retailers like Amazon.

It is necessary to close your key fob again after replacing the battery. You should test the lock, unlock and start functions. If you notice that they're not working, it could be a good thing to have the key fob programmed by locksmiths.
